我正在尝试整合完整的日历插件(adam Arshaw's)。我需要显示月份名称。当我尝试提醒month.getMonth();它显示了月份的数值。即。 7月份它显示7.我需要将它显示为完整的月份。例如。七月或七月。这怎么可能?请帮忙
答案 0 :(得分:3)
快速,肮脏的解决方案。有一个月的数组
var months = ['January','February','March','April','May','June','July','August','September','October','November' ,'十二月'];
然后通过扣除1获得所需的完整月份,因为我们的数组索引以0开头。
months[month.getMonth()-1]
答案 1 :(得分:1)
根据您在上一个问题中的评论:
fullCalendar有一个monthNamesShort数组,您可以在声明期间定义它。
select: function(start, end, allDay) {
if(start < date)
{
var shortName = this.calendar.options.monthNamesShort[start.getMonth() - 1];
alert(shortName);
}
},
只需通过日历选项访问它。